Promotions, Promotions, Promotions!Friday, 16 September 2011 Use a promotion to encourage customer devotionIf you want to encourage customers to visit you more frequently and spend more when they do (and why wouldn’t you?) then using gift cards for promotional campaigns can be extremely effective. Simple promotions like spend £100 in-store and receive a free £10 gift card towards your next visit not only encourages customers to spend more in store but drives increased footfall and the chance of increased spend later.
You can even have promotional cards that have limited expiry to encourage customers to spend them within a certain timeframe e.g. £100 gift card towards your next holiday when you book within the next four weeks. This not only limits your outstanding liability but it encourages customers to shop with you within a defined period, perhaps when business is quieter?
Why not approach key suppliers to secure co-marketing funds? You can then use those funds to drive sales of their products or services, e.g. a free £50 gift card when you purchase any Samsung flat screen TV this weekend (T&C’s apply of course!). They get a sale and you get a happy customer who’ll come back to you to spend that card value and more.
